If you think Amazon is a large-scale retailer, you’d be right, but only by Earth standards. Next to Kablam!, the galaxy’s largest retailer, that familiar online behemoth seems downright quaint. And like so many large organizations, they have secrets; secrets they want kept out of the light.

It seems the Doctor has received a cry for help from someone inside the monolithic company. Someone has gone missing and the Doctor suspects they’re not the first to do so.

Naturally, a company the size of Kablam! uses robotic help, but did they have to pick such creepy automatons? Of course they did. Also, watch for a familiar face from Chris Chibnall’s Broadchurch.

Episode description from BBC America:

Episode Seven: Kerblam!

“Delivery for the Doctor!” A mysterious message arrives in a package addressed to the Doctor, leading her, Graham, Yaz and Ryan to investigate the warehouse moon orbiting Kandoka, and the home of the galaxy’s largest retailer: Kerblam!

Guest starring Julie Hesmondhalgh and Lee Mack. Written by Pete McTighe. Directed by Jennifer Perrott!
